Home
last modified time | relevance | path

Searched refs:aeqs (Results 1 – 5 of 5) sorted by relevance

/f-stack/dpdk/drivers/net/hinic/base/
H A Dhinic_pmd_eqs.c400 struct hinic_aeqs *aeqs; in hinic_aeqs_init() local
404 aeqs = kzalloc(sizeof(*aeqs), GFP_KERNEL); in hinic_aeqs_init()
405 if (!aeqs) in hinic_aeqs_init()
408 hwdev->aeqs = aeqs; in hinic_aeqs_init()
409 aeqs->hwdev = hwdev; in hinic_aeqs_init()
410 aeqs->num_aeqs = num_aeqs; in hinic_aeqs_init()
426 remove_aeq(&aeqs->aeq[i]); in hinic_aeqs_init()
428 kfree(aeqs); in hinic_aeqs_init()
439 struct hinic_aeqs *aeqs = hwdev->aeqs; in hinic_aeqs_free() local
444 remove_aeq(&aeqs->aeq[q_id]); in hinic_aeqs_free()
[all …]
H A Dhinic_pmd_mgmt.c788 hwdev->pf_to_mgmt->rx_aeq = &hwdev->aeqs->aeq[HINIC_MGMT_RSP_AEQN]; in hinic_comm_pf_to_mgmt_init()
804 struct hinic_eq *aeq = &hwdev->aeqs->aeq[0]; in hinic_dev_handle_aeq_event()
H A Dhinic_pmd_hwdev.c733 struct hinic_aeqs *aeqs = nic_hwdev->aeqs; in init_aeqs_msix_attr() local
745 for (q_id = 0; q_id < aeqs->num_aeqs; q_id++) { in init_aeqs_msix_attr()
746 eq = &aeqs->aeq[q_id]; in init_aeqs_msix_attr()
H A Dhinic_pmd_hwdev.h440 struct hinic_aeqs *aeqs; member
H A Dhinic_pmd_mbox.c980 hwdev->func_to_func->ack_aeq = &hwdev->aeqs->aeq[msg_ack_aeqn]; in hinic_comm_func_to_func_init()
981 hwdev->func_to_func->recv_aeq = &hwdev->aeqs->aeq[HINIC_AEQN_0]; in hinic_comm_func_to_func_init()